The Hilzinger Block is a commercial building located at 106-110 South Main Street in Royal Oak, Michigan.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2006.

History

The Hilzinger Block building was completed in 1925 as the Hilzinger Hardware Store. for Albert Hilzinger. Hilzinger's sons, Raymond and Franklin, took over the business in the 1950s, and ran it as the Hilzinger Brothers Hardware Store until 2002, after which the building was vacant for a time. The building was renovated numerous times, including a 1963 renovation that covered the external facade with sheet metal. The building was purchased in 2003 by 2mission, who rehabilitated the building and restored the original brick facade, and brought in five tenants to the building.

Description

The Hilzinger Block is a 12000 square feet, two story brick building. The current facade is similar to the original, and includes an unusual multi-light transom over the first-floor storefronts that was re-created from old photographs.
